    There is also a range of styles, like an l shaped sectional with chaise-shaped sectional or a U-shaped one. An L-shaped sectional has two sections that form an L shape, while a U-shaped sectional consists of three sections that are one in the middle and two on either side. It is important to determine the space you have before purchasing any furniture, no matter the size or shape. As a general rule you should leave around a foot in between your sectional and any other furniture pieces to ensure that you have enough room to fully recline.

    You'll also have to decide whether you'd prefer either a manual or a power recliner. A manual sectional requires you to manually pull the lever on the back of the sofa in order to recline. A power sectional allows you to simply press a button to move into your desired recliner position. Some recliner sectionals come with storage and cup holders to help you keep your living space neat.

    Once you've determined the overall size and design of your recliner and you've decided on the style, it's time to pick the upholstery. Leather sectional couches are popular because of their timeless style and easy-to-clean fabric that is able to withstand the abuse of children and pets. Fabric sectionals are favored by many homeowners because they are more comfortable and don't get hot or cold in the summer sun.

    Another crucial aspect to consider when shopping for an reclining sectional is the number of seats and how much space you need. For some people who are looking for a large reclining sectional is ideal because it can hold a lot of guests for movie nights with the family or games. Others prefer a smaller reclining sectional that can fit into a smaller space or an open floor plan. Some people opt for a modular sectional which lets them move pieces around to adjust the seating according to their requirements.

    If you decide to opt for modular sectionals, be sure to take measurements of the space in which it will be placed. Be sure that there aren't any "pinch-points" where the sectional meets furniture or walls. This could result in an unnatural look.
